Hardware/software partitioning aiming at fulfilment of real-time constraints

摘要

Whether a real-time system meets its timing constraints depends to a large extent on which hardware architecture is used, and how the functionality is distributed on it. This article discusses how such design decisions can be supported by hardware/software codesign. An implementation quality metric - the minimal required speedup — is presented, which indicates how well the timing constraints are fulfilled, and it is shown how to calculate this using an extension of fixed-priority scheduling analysis. A partitioning algorithm is developed, which assigns tasks to architecture components in an attempt to meet the timing constraints at a minimal cost.
